PayPal PHP Merchant SDK

Overview

The merchant SDK can be used for integrating with the Express Checkout, Mass Pay, Web Payments Pro APIs.

Prerequisites

PayPal's PHP Merchant SDK requires

  • PHP 5.2 and above with curl/openssl extensions enabled

Installing the SDK

if not using composer

run installation script from merchant-sdk-php/samples directory

curl  https://raw.github.com/paypal/merchant-sdk-php/composer/samples/install.php | php

    or 
    
php install.php

if using composer

Run from merchant-sdk-php/samples directory and after the installation set the path to config file in PPBootStrap.php, config file is in vendor/paypal/merchant-sdk-php/config/

composer update

Using the SDK

To use the SDK,

  • Update the sdk_config.ini with your API credentials.
  • Require "PPBootStrap.php" in your application. [copy it from vendor/paypal/merchant-sdk-php/sample/ if using composer]
  • To run samples : copy samples in [vendor/paypal/merchant-sdk-php/] to root directory and run in browser
  • To build your own application:
  • Create a service wrapper object.
  • Create a request object as per your project's needs. All the API request and response classes are available in services\PayPalAPIInterfaceService\PayPalAPIInterfaceServiceService.php
  • Invoke the appropriate method on the service object.

For example,

//sets config file path and loads all the classes
require("PPBootStrap.php");

// Create request details
$itemAmount = new BasicAmountType($currencyId, $amount);
$setECReqType = new SetExpressCheckoutRequestType();
$setECReqType->SetExpressCheckoutRequestDetails = $setECReqDetails;

// Create request
$setECReq = new SetExpressCheckoutReq();
$setECReq->SetExpressCheckoutRequest = $setECReqType;
......

// Perform request
$paypalService = new PayPalAPIInterfaceServiceService();
$setECResponse = $paypalService->SetExpressCheckout($setECReq);

// Check results
$ack = strtoupper($setECResponse->Ack);
if($ack == 'SUCCESS') {
	// Success
}  

The SDK provides multiple ways to authenticate your API call.

$paypalService = new PayPalAPIInterfaceServiceService();

// Use the default account (the first account) configured in sdk_config.ini
$response = $paypalService->SetExpressCheckout($setECReq);

// Use a specific account configured in sdk_config.inig
$response = $paypalService->SetExpressCheckout($setECReq, 'jb-us-seller_api1.paypal.com');
 
// Pass in a dynamically created API credential object
$cred = new PPCertificateCredential("username", "password", "path-to-pem-file");
$cred->setThirdPartyAuthorization(new PPTokenAuthorization("accessToken", "tokenSecret"));
$response = $paypalService->SetExpressCheckout($setECReq, $cred);

SDK Configuration

Replace the API credential in config/sdk_config.ini . You can use the configuration file to configure

  • (Multiple) API account credentials.
  • Service endpoint and other HTTP connection parameters
  • Logging

Please refer to the sample config file provided with this bundle.
